Mastering the AI Product Description Tool
Prompt Engineering for D2C Success
The effectiveness of an AI product description tool depends entirely on prompt quality.
AI performs best when given clear, structured, and detailed instructions.
Essential Prompt Components
Product Name and Type
Define exactly what the product is and its category.
Target Audience
Specify demographics, psychographics, motivations, and pain points.
Key Features and Benefits
Translate features into customer-facing outcomes.
Desired Tone and Style
Define the brand voice clearly with descriptors or examples.
SEO Keywords
Provide primary and secondary keywords for integration.
Call to Action
Clarify what action the reader should take.
Length and Format
Specify word count and structure (paragraphs, bullets, narrative).
Example Prompt (Structured)
-
Product: Serenity Blend Organic Herbal Tea
-
Audience: Health-conscious adults (30–55) seeking stress relief
-
Features and benefits:
-
Organic herbs → natural relaxation
-
Small-batch blending → premium quality
-
Caffeine-free → ideal for evenings
-
-
Tone: Calm, luxurious, natural
-
Keywords: organic herbal tea, stress relief tea, loose leaf tea
-
CTA: “Indulge in tranquility”
-
Length: 150–200 words
This level of specificity dramatically improves output relevance and quality.
Beyond Generation: Refining AI Output for D2C Brands
AI should be treated as a first-draft engine, not a final authority.
Best Practices for Refinement
Human Review and Editing
Ensure accuracy, tone alignment, and brand consistency.
Fact-Checking
Verify technical claims, specifications, and compliance details.
Brand Authenticity
Inject emotional nuance and brand storytelling where needed.
A/B Testing
Use AI-generated variations to test performance and optimize conversions.
Example Workflow Integration
-
Product team provides specifications
-
Marketing generates AI drafts
-
Editor refines for brand voice and SEO
-
Description is published and monitored
This hybrid workflow maximizes efficiency without sacrificing quality.

How do I make sure the AI-generated descriptions still sound like my brand?
This is crucial. When you prompt the AI, clearly state your brand’s voice and tone. For example, ‘Write in a witty and casual tone,’ or ‘Use sophisticated and elegant language.’ You can even provide snippets of your existing brand copy as examples. Then, always edit the AI’s output to inject your unique brand personality and ensure consistency.
Are there any common mistakes or things to watch out for when using AI for this?
Definitely. The biggest one is not reviewing or editing the AI’s output. AI can sometimes make up facts (hallucinations), miss nuances, or generate repetitive phrases. Always fact-check, refine the language. ensure it accurately reflects your product and brand. Treat it as a powerful draft generator, not a final copywriter.
